Course Overview
Why This Course
Strategic planning is essential for organizations that want to move with clarity, focus, and purpose. A strong strategic plan helps leaders understand their environment, define direction, set priorities, align resources, engage stakeholders, and turn ambition into practical action.
This intensive 5-day Strategic Planning Training program equips participants with the tools and skills needed to develop, implement, monitor, and adapt strategic plans effectively. The course covers environmental analysis, strategic thinking, SWOT analysis, vision and mission development, goal setting, stakeholder engagement, strategy formulation, competitive positioning, Balanced Scorecard, strategy maps, resource allocation, change management, communication, KPIs, strategic control, risk management, and continuous improvement. Through practical exercises and real-world examples, participants will learn how to create strategic plans that guide action and support organizational success.

The Program Flow
Day 1: Foundations of Strategic Planning
- Understand strategic planning concepts and their practical value.
- Explore the strategic environment and key drivers of change.
- Apply environmental scanning to identify opportunities and threats.
- Use SWOT analysis to assess organizational strengths, weaknesses, opportunities, and threats.
- Build strategic thinking skills for better long-term decision-making.
Day 2: Vision, Mission, and Goal Setting
- Craft clear and meaningful vision and mission statements.
- Set SMART strategic goals and measurable objectives.
- Align organizational values with strategic direction.
- Identify key stakeholders and understand their expectations.
- Develop stakeholder engagement approaches that support strategic commitment.
Day 3: Strategy Formulation and Tools
- Explore strategic planning models and frameworks.
- Conduct competitive analysis and assess positioning.
- Use Balanced Scorecard concepts to connect strategy with performance.
- Develop strategy maps to clarify cause-and-effect relationships.
- Prioritize resources, projects, and initiatives based on strategic importance.
Day 4: Strategy Implementation
- Translate strategic objectives into action plans.
- Align organizational structure, roles, and resources with strategy.
- Apply change management techniques to support implementation.
- Develop communication strategies for buy-in and engagement.
- Build accountability mechanisms for strategy execution.
Day 5: Monitoring, Evaluation, and Adaptation
- Define KPIs and metrics for tracking strategic performance.
- Develop strategic control systems.
- Monitor progress and identify performance gaps.
- Apply continuous improvement and strategy adaptation techniques.
- Manage strategic risks and uncertainties that may affect execution.
